Tap & Tonic | Pub and Bistro is a casual dining spot located in the heart of Marmora, Ontario. The restaurant offers a mix of classic pub fare with a modern twist, featuring dishes like fish tacos and mushroom-filled options. The menu balances hearty, familiar comforts with small creative touches. The interior provides a relaxed atmosphere, combining a bar area, pool table, and dining space that encourage both socializing and laid-back meals. Background rock and roll music and occasional live performances contribute to the welcoming vibe. This venue serves as a local gathering place where patrons can enjoy cold beers, approachable food, and friendly service. Whether stopping by after a bike ride or during a road trip, guests can expect a straightforward dining experience rooted in traditional pub culture with enough variety to appeal to diverse tastes.

Nice restaurant located in the center of town. Pool table, bar area and eating area provide a relaxing atmosphere. Stuff Chicken breast with Mash potatoes and roasted veggies was really nice. Waitress was prompt and friendly, was nice after a very long bike ride from Lake St.Peter. Thanks for a nice meal and refreshing cold beer.
Bartender/server was quick, service was quick, Food was great, and lots of it. We are already planning our next trip.
Had take out so can't comment on atmosphere, sad I couldn't go back and check out the karaoke later in the evening lol Fries were deeeeelicious, reminds me of the old dairy queen fries before they changed them. Nostalgic and tasty! Also had the chicken caesar wrap which had a really decent amount of meat in there, no complaints at all. My husband enjoyed his food as well :) (double deck burger and poutine was what he had)
Stopped off here during a long drive from Toronto to Ottawa - I'm glad I did! Live music was great and the drinks selection was decent. Lots of lovely locals to chat and sing along with. I was a little skeptical of the food as the menu seemed standard pub fare, but it was actually great! Some of the best wings, fries and pickles I've had in Canada.
